Efficient Firewall Rulebase Management
Maintaining a robust security posture demands diligent policy management. As organizations grow, their configurations inevitably become more complex. Without a structured approach, this can lead to performance slowdown, increased operational costs, and potentially, critical security vulnerabilities. A proactive plan for policy control should include regular audits, automated identification of rules, and the ability to quickly implement changes. Furthermore, centralized visibility and effective change control are key to ensuring consistent network effectiveness and minimizing the risk of unauthorized access.
